Position Purpose
The Raw Material Receiving Technician is responsible for the accurate and efficient unloading, inspection, and documentation of all inbound raw materials used in production at Farmina Pet Foods. This position ensures that only safe, high-quality ingredients and packaging materials enter the facility by verifying compliance with company standards and regulatory requirements. By maintaining accuracy in receiving and inventory records, this role directly supports food safety, production efficiency, and the consistent delivery of premium pet food products.

Key Responsibilities
- Receive and unload inbound raw materials, ingredients, and packaging supplies in accordance with company policies and safety standards.
- Inspect shipments for accuracy, quality, and compliance with specifications and food safety requirements.
- Verify documentation including bills of lading, certificates of analysis, and purchase orders.
- Accurately enter data into inventory management systems and maintain receiving logs.
- Properly label, store, and stage materials in designated warehouse or production areas.
- Operate forklifts, pallet jacks, and other material-handling equipment safely.
- Report discrepancies, damage, or quality concerns to supervisors and Quality Assurance.
- Work with production and scheduling teams to ensure timely availability of raw materials.
- Follow all GMPs (Good Manufacturing Practices), food safety protocols, and OSHA workplace safety standards.
- Maintain cleanliness and organization of receiving docks and storage areas.
